What is required for the bonding method of electrical systems in agricultural settings?

In agricultural settings, the use of rigid metal conduit as part of the bonding method for electrical systems is essential due to several key factors. Rigid metal conduit provides physical protection for electrical wiring and is particularly advantageous in environments where there may be exposure to moisture, dust, or potential physical damage, which is common in agricultural operations.

This type of conduit also aids in grounding and bonding the electrical systems effectively. Its metallic nature allows for effective electrical continuity and grounding, which is crucial for safety and the proper functioning of electrical systems. Proper grounding prevents electrical faults which could pose hazards to individuals working with or around electrical equipment in agricultural settings.

While other options like flexible conduit, non-metallic conduit, and direct burial cable may have specific applications, they do not offer the same level of physical protection and grounding capabilities that rigid metal conduit provides in agricultural environments. Therefore, rigid metal conduit fulfills the necessary requirements for bonding in these settings, ensuring both safety and compliance with electrical codes.
